Nominated for five Oscar awards (including Best Picture, Best Actor, Best Supporting Actress and Best Original Screenplay) The Holdovers is a comedy drama about three lonely, shipwrecked people at a New England boarding school over a very snowy holiday break in 1970.

Paul Giamatti is Paul Hunham, a grouchy professor of ancient history who is universally disliked by students and school and ends up spending the holiday with Mary Lamb (Da’Vine Joy Randolph) the head cook of the school whose only child Curtis was killed in Vietnam and Angus Tully (Dominic Sessa in his film debut), a student at the school - a smart, damaged, troublemaker but a good kid underneath who’s just trying to make his way.

Left to their own devices in the empty school, there are adventures, a little calamity and finally, a semblance of family.
